== Switch Basics ==

A switch is often to turn something on or off. In the simplest case it is just a wire that is connected or not. Unplugging an appliance is one way to switch it off. A switch is usually a mechanical device where some sort of handle connects or disconnects conductors inside the switch. Another way of thinking of a switch is that it is like a resistor that sometimes has infinite resistance and sometimes has 0 resistance. A computer keyboard is made of a large number of switches. Some switches stay in the on or off position, others only stay on or off while you switch them, these are called momentary switches. A light switch is normally not momentary, a doorbell switch normally is momentary.

== Relays ==

A [[relay]] is a switch that is turned on and off by an electro-magnet. (So-called "solid state relays" do not use an electro-magnet ).  Like other switching devices it allows a small amount of power to control a large amount of power.  A nice feature of relays is that there is no electrical connection between the control circuit and the circuit connected to the switch. ( this is called electrical isolation ).  They are often used to let low power digital circuits control normal 110v power in a home.
